41-year-old Sally Ann Johnson of Massachusetts, who call themselves psychic, sentenced to 26 months in prison after she tried to avoid paying taxes with the amount of 3.5 million dollars.

According to Reuters, this amount of «psychic» received from 2007 to 2014 from an elderly woman suffering from dementia. The woman believed possessed by evil spirits, and Sally Johnson «delivered» her from them.

According to district court judge Denise Casper in Boston, and «psychic» took advantage of a defenseless woman, which is seen as a fraud.

In addition to imprisonment, Sally Ann will return to the client the amount received and to pay 725 thousand dollars to the US government as restitution for tax evasion.

Johnson, and two have not completed grade school (!), called themselves «Gypsy psychic». She pleaded guilty to tax evasion but denied that he used the dementia client, to trick her. The lawyers of the accused said that the client, whose name was not called, was intelligent and fully aware of what he does.

According to court documents, the elderly woman at the time was studying at Harvard. It was very rich and was always inclined to believe in the presence of evil forces. Over the years her disease has increased and symptoms of dementia, the woman was attributed to demonic possession. She hoped Sally Johnson will help her.

Johnson used a fake name, and the client transferred her money into three different Bank accounts. Many «psychic» took cash to hide the source of money. In addition, she also used the credit card of an elderly woman spent about 20 thousand dollars on entertainment and jewelry.
